Prosoft - Virginia Beach, VA
posted 3 months ago
The Database Administrator/Developer position at PROSOFT involves working as part of a larger team and in small project teams to design, create, maintain, and manage Command databases. The role requires expertise in Extract Transform Load (ETL) solutions, indexes, T-SQL, and data manipulation scripts, including stored procedures, tables, views, functions, reports, and forms. The successful candidate will apply Department of Defense (DoD) data standards to all software applications and database data elements, ensuring that logical data models are fully attributed and normalized. In this role, you will provide technical support for various database operations, including creation, modification, testing, administration, monitoring, tuning, backup, and recovery. You will also be responsible for designing and creating SQL Server Integration Services (SSIS) packages and providing SQL Server Reporting Services (SSRS) for the delivery of information. Monitoring and maintaining databases to ensure optimal performance is a key aspect of this position, along with implementing data management standards, requirements, and specifications. Additionally, you will work on data mining and data warehousing applications, employing Agile methodology and Scrum framework for software development projects. The ideal candidate will have a strong background in database management systems, query languages, and data analysis, with a focus on normalization, ETL processes, and business rules. You will need to demonstrate skills in database creation and development in Microsoft SQL Server, including SSIS, T-SQL, SQL agent jobs, and SQL Reports. The ability to optimize database performance and manage complex database structures is essential, as is the capacity to thrive in a dynamic, fast-paced environment.